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ken thighs
- 1 cup fresh Thai basil leaves
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 medium red bell pepper, sliced thinly
- 2 tbsp vegetable oil
- 3 t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
- 2 tbsp oyster sauce
- 1 tsp brown sugar
Instructions
- Prepare the chicken by cutting it into bite-sized pieces and seasoning lightly with salt and pepper.
-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at. Add chicken in batches if necessary, cooking until golden brown (5-7 minutes).
- Stir in minced garlic and sliced bell pepper; cook for an additional minute until fragrant.
- In a small bowl, mix soy sauce, oyster sauce, and brown sugar until dissolved. Pour over chicken and vegetables.
- Add fresh basil leaves last; toss everything together for about one minute until basil wilts. Serve over steamed jasmine rice or noodles.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
